SNI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

447 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Scripps Networks Interactive, Inc Common Class A (SNI)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$5.69B — up 2.7% from $5.54B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 48 funds closed out of SNI and 47 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 162 trimmed existing stakes and 167 added.

The largest buyer was Thrivent Financial for Lutherans, adding an estimated $34.3M. The largest seller was BlackRock Institutional Trust, cutting an estimated $28.4M.
